Al-Qaida in Iraq claimed in a new audio tape on Friday to be winning the war in Iraq with 12,000 fighters mobilized in the wartorn country and praised the Republicans’ defeat in U.S. midterm elections as “reasonable”

“The al-Qaida army has 12,000 fighters in Iraq, and they have vowed to die for God’s sake” said Abu Hamza al-Muhajir, in an audio tape made available on militant web sites.

Also known as Abu Ayyub al-Masri, al-Muhajir became the leader of al-Qaida in Iraq after Abu Musab al-Zarqawi was killed by the U.S. military in June.

Though the voice on the tape identified itself as al-Masri, there were no means to independently verify this. (Source)
